**Q: Why is the PointsPerch ledger read-only this week?** A: Quarterly reconciliation. Writes are frozen while we replay the event log against the Marrowgate mirror. Don't patch balances manually — it breaks checksums. If you need the reconciliation workspace, it's sealed until Friday. On-call can unseal early for genuine incidents only. To unseal, enter the workspace recovery passphrase, shown on the line below:

unlock words, fahog-yahof: belael-holael-eliius-joreth-tamax-olimir-norwyn-holwyn-fraath-lamius-norwyn-druys-soriel

Plugin authors: Quarrel, our homegrown job queue, is deprecated. All Fenwick Platform plugins must target TaskBarge by the v4 cutoff. Enqueue via the TaskBarge SDK; old Quarrel hooks will no-op after migration week. Retries are automatic, idempotency keys required. Dead-letter inspection lives in the Barge console under your plugin namespace. To unlock the migration sandbox for your plugin, use the shared recovery vault. The vault accepts the passphrase printed below.

recovery phrase for fajeg-hagug: holox-fenmir

Changelog — Eng Sync, Week 14 (Project Larkspur)

Renamed LINT_BASELINE_PATH to ANALYSIS_BASELINE_FILE across all Larkspur repos. Old name still reads for two releases, then hard-fails. Reason: the baseline now covers type-checks and dead-code scans, not just lint. CI images rebuilt; the Brindlehaus runner picks up the new name automatically. Local devs must update their env files manually. The baseline sync also now authenticates to the artifact store, so add this line right after the rename.

sealed setting: RELAY_SECRET5=82864